加入收藏 | 设为首页 | 会员中心 | 我要投稿 好传媒网 (https://www.haochuanmei.com/)- 区块链、物联平台、物联安全、数据迁移、5G!
当前位置: 首页 > 综合聚焦 > 编程要点 > 语言 > 正文

编程精粹:多语言掌控,解码高效编码核心技巧

发布时间:2025-04-05 13:21:28 所属栏目:语言 来源:DaWei
导读: 在当今数字化时代,编程已然成为了连接现实与数字世界的桥梁。掌握多门编程语言并精通高效编码技巧,不仅能拓宽职业的广度,还能深化技术的深度。编程精粹的核心,在于理解语言的共通原

在当今数字化时代,编程已然成为了连接现实与数字世界的桥梁。掌握多门编程语言并精通高效编码技巧,不仅能拓宽职业的广度,还能深化技术的深度。编程精粹的核心,在于理解语言的共通原理与差异,以及在实战中灵活应用最佳实践。

多语言精通并不意味着浅尝辄止地学习每种语言的基础语法。它要求深入理解每种语言的哲学、设计理念和适用场景。例如,Python的简洁优雅适合快速原型开发,Java的严谨面向对象设计则在企业级应用中占有一席之地。C++的底层控制能力使其成为游戏引擎和系统软件的首选。学习多语言,实际上是培养跨语法的思维能力,使代码更加灵活、高效。

高效编码不仅仅是追求代码的短小精悍,更重要的是确保代码的可读性、可维护性和可扩展性。采用模块化和面向对象的设计原则,可以显著提高代码的组织性和重用率。同时,熟悉并遵守编码规范,如PEP 8(Python)、Google Java Style Guide等,能让团队合作更加顺畅无阻。利用单元测试和持续集成工具,可以确保代码质量,减少后期维护成本。

掌握算法和数据结构是成为高效程序员的关键。理解基本的数据类型(如数组、链表、树、图)和高级算法(如动态规划、分治策略),能够让你在面对复杂问题时迅速找到最优解。熟悉常见的设计模式,如工厂模式、单例模式、观察者模式,可以帮助你构建更加健壮和灵活的系统架构。

时间管理与问题解决能力同样不可或缺。一个好的开发者懂得如何分解任务、处理优先级,并能有效利用调试工具和资源解决问题。参与开源项目、技术社区和编程竞赛,不仅能提升实战技巧,还能拓宽视野,了解行业最新动态和技术趋势。

AI绘制图示,仅供参考

站长个人见解,编程精粹在于不断学习与实践,将理论知识与自然语言处理、人工智能等前沿技术相结合,形成自己的技术体系。在这个过程中,不仅要重视技术的广度,更要深化深度,做到真正的多语言精通与高效编码。

(编辑:好传媒网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章